What's a good side hustle for nurses?

Part-time 8 Hour RNs can pursue side hustles such as telehealth consulting, medical writing, or health coaching, which leverage their clinical knowledge and communication skills. These options often offer flexible schedules and can be done remotely, making them suitable for nurses seeking additional income outside their primary job.

What is the difference between Part Time 8 Hour Rn vs Part Time 8 Hour Lpn?

AspectPart Time 8 Hour RnPart Time 8 Hour Lpn
CredentialsRegistered Nurse licenseLicensed Practical Nurse license
Work EnvironmentHospitals, clinics, long-term careAssisted living, long-term care, clinics
Job ResponsibilitiesAdvanced patient care, assessments, medication administrationBasic patient care, vital signs, assisting with procedures

Part Time 8 Hour Rns and Lpns both work in healthcare settings with overlapping environments, but Rns typically handle more complex patient care and assessments, while Lpns focus on basic care tasks. Both roles require specific licenses and are vital in patient care teams, with Rns often taking on more advanced responsibilities.

Can you work 8 hours as a nurse?

Yes, registered nurses (RNs) often work 8-hour shifts as part of their standard schedule, especially in hospital or clinical settings. These shifts typically include day, evening, or night hours, and may require working weekends or holidays depending on the facility's staffing needs.
